There are many many srividya sampradayas --around 32 . Of which just a handful remain. There is Dakshinachara,vamachara,dravidachara,keralachara,andhrachara,lopamudra,a gasthyachara,dravidaaachara,cheracharaa,kashmiraachara....the list goes on and on. I know around 32 types but there might be more than that. Let me be conservative here. 3. Lopamudra sampradaya does not exist as a practice but some Tamil Naadi granthas(palm leave manuscripts) containing the agasthya jeeva naadi and agasthya naadi contains the practice tenets of both agasthyaachara and lopaamudraachara(his wife) some opine that She is the only woman who is capable of teaching properly as she has controlled Her menses flow completely. Also She is a great Brahmarishi Patni. Jaya Agasthya Braham rishi Jaya Lopamudraa Matha Some say that having a woman Guru is 16 times more powerful than a Male guru.
